Job Description
We are seeking a proactive and analytical Finance Business Partner – Plant / Operations to support the financial management of a manufacturing plant in Denmark. This role involves partnering closely with the plant management team to drive financial performance, optimize processes, and contribute to international projects like ERP implementations. The successful candidate will be hands-on, results-driven, and comfortable working in an international environment.

Responsibilities
-Act as a financial advisor and sparring partner to the Plant Management Team in Nyborg.
-Analyze operational KPIs such as productivity, efficiency, yield, and costs, providing insights and improvements.
-Monitor and optimize standard costs and profit margins.
-Perform variance analyses related to volume, product mix, pricing, and efficiency.
-Support and challenge investment decisions and business cases for CapEx projects.
-Contribute actively to ERP implementation and IT transformation initiatives.
-Promote process improvements and standardization within operations.
-Participate in cross-location improvement projects and initiatives.
-Report directly to the Group Operations Controller and be part of the Operations Control team.
